Image of Rachel's Fancy Macaroni and Cheese
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:30 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 16 oz elbow macaroni
  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 3 tbsp all-purpose flour
  • 3 cups whole milk
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 2.5 cups s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 1.5 cups Gruyère cheese, shredded
  • 0.5 c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 0.5 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 0.5 tsp black pepper
  • 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ped (optional gar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

Step 2

Cook the elbow macaroni according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.

Step 3

In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Once melted, whisk in the flour and cook for 1-2 minutes until golden and bubbly.

Step 4

Gradually pour in the milk and heavy cream, whisking constantly to avoid lumps. Bring the mixture to a low simmer and cook for 4-5 minutes, or until thickened.

Step 5

Reduce heat to low and stir in the shredded cheddar, Gruyère, and Parmesan cheeses. Mix until the cheeses are fully melted and the sauce is creamy.

Step 6

Add the Dijon mustard,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per to the cheese sauce. Stir well to combine.

Step 7

Add the cooked macaroni to the cheese sauce and stir to coat each piece of pasta evenly.

Step 8

Pour the macaroni and cheese mixture into a greased 9x13-inch baking dish and spread evenly.

Step 9

In a small bowl, mix the panko breadcrumbs with olive oil. Sprinkle the breadcrumb mixture evenly over the top of the mac and cheese.

Step 10

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and crispy.

Step 11

Remove from the oven and let cool for 5 minutes.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ving, if desired.
